如何明确需求信息管理系统 (怎么明确需求)

如何明确需求信息管理系统 (怎么明确需求)

明确需求信息管理系统的方法包括:定义需求目标、识别利益相关者、收集和分析需求、优先级排序、选择合适的工具。

其中,定义需求目标是关键的一步。通过明确系统的目标,您可以确保所有利益相关者对系统的期望一致,从而减少误解和冲突。目标应该具体、可测量、可实现、相关且有时限(SMART原则)。定义目标后,您可以根据这些目标来评估和选择适合的需求管理工具,如或。

一、定义需求目标

定义需求目标是需求信息管理系统的基础步骤。它有助于明确系统的方向和最终成果,确保所有利益相关者对系统的期望一致。目标应当遵循SMART原则,即具体(Specific)、可测量(Measurable)、可实现(Achievable)、相关(Relevant)和有时限(Time-bound)。例如,如果目标是提高 项目管理 的效率,您需要定义具体的提高指标,如项目完成时间缩短20%。

明确目标后,您可以根据这些目标来评估和选择合适的需求管理工具。例如,PingCode是一款国内市场占有率非常高的需求管理工具,它提供了强大的需求追踪和管理功能,可以帮助团队更好地实现项目目标。【 PingCode官网

二、识别利益相关者

识别利益相关者是另一个重要步骤。利益相关者包括所有对项目有影响或受项目影响的人员或组织。识别利益相关者可以确保所有相关方的需求都被考虑,从而减少后期的变更和冲突。常见的利益相关者包括项目经理、开发团队、测试团队、客户和最终用户。

与利益相关者进行沟通,了解他们的需求和期望,是成功实施需求信息管理系统的关键。您可以通过会议、访谈、调查问卷等方式收集利益相关者的需求。确保每个利益相关者的需求都被记录和分析,以便在系统设计和开发过程中得到充分考虑。

三、收集和分析需求

收集和分析需求是需求信息管理系统的核心步骤。需求收集可以通过多种方式进行,如头脑风暴、需求研讨会、用户故事、用例分析等。收集到的需求应当详细记录,并进行分类和优先级排序。

需求分析是将收集到的需求转化为系统功能和特性的过程。通过需求分析,您可以识别出系统的关键功能和非功能需求,如性能、安全性、可用性等。需求分析的结果应当形成详细的需求文档,作为系统设计和开发的基础。

四、优先级排序

在需求管理过程中,优先级排序是一个重要环节。由于资源和时间的限制,所有需求不可能同时得到实现,因此需要对需求进行优先级排序。优先级排序可以根据需求的重要性、紧急程度、实现难度等因素进行。

常见的优先级排序方法包括MoSCoW法(Must have, Should have, Could have, Won't have)、Kano模型、价值-成本分析等。通过优先级排序,您可以确保最重要和最紧急的需求优先得到实现,从而提高项目的成功率。

五、选择合适的工具

选择合适的需求管理工具对于需求信息管理系统的成功至关重要。需求管理工具应当具备需求收集、分析、追踪和管理的功能,并且易于使用和集成。例如,PingCode是一款国内市场占有率非常高的需求管理工具,提供了强大的需求追踪和管理功能,适合各类项目的需求管理。【PingCode官网】

Worktile则是一款通用型的项目管理系统,具备需求管理、任务管理、时间管理等多种功能,适合各种规模的项目管理需求。【 Worktile官网

在选择工具时,您应当根据项目的具体需求和团队的使用习惯进行评估和比较,确保选择的工具能够满足需求信息管理的要求,并且易于团队成员上手使用。

六、制定需求管理计划

制定需求管理计划是确保需求信息管理系统成功实施的重要步骤。需求管理计划应当包括需求收集、分析、追踪、变更管理等各个环节的具体流程和方法。计划应当详细描述如何收集和分析需求,如何进行需求优先级排序,如何管理需求变更等。

需求管理计划还应当包括需求管理的时间表和责任分工,确保每个环节都有专人负责,并在规定的时间内完成。通过制定详细的需求管理计划,您可以确保需求信息管理系统的各个环节有序进行,提高项目的成功率。

七、进行需求验证和确认

需求验证和确认是确保需求信息管理系统准确和完整的重要步骤。需求验证是检查需求文档的准确性和完整性,确保需求描述清晰、无歧义。需求确认是与利益相关者进行沟通,确保需求文档中的需求符合他们的期望和要求。

需求验证和确认可以通过需求评审、原型设计、用户测试等方式进行。通过需求验证和确认,您可以确保需求信息管理系统的需求准确、完整,减少后期的变更和冲突。

八、实施需求变更管理

在需求信息管理系统的实施过程中,需求变更是不可避免的。因此,需求变更管理是需求管理的重要环节。需求变更管理应当包括需求变更的提出、评估、批准和实施等环节。

需求变更管理应当遵循严格的流程,确保每个变更都经过充分评估和批准,减少不必要的变更和对项目的影响。通过有效的需求变更管理,您可以确保需求信息管理系统的稳定性和可靠性。

九、进行需求追踪和监控

需求追踪和监控是确保需求信息管理系统按计划实施的重要步骤。需求追踪是指对需求的实现过程进行跟踪,确保每个需求都得到实现。需求监控是指对需求的实现情况进行监控,及时发现和解决问题。

需求追踪和监控可以通过需求管理工具进行,如PingCode或Worktile。通过需求追踪和监控,您可以确保需求信息管理系统按计划实施,提高项目的成功率。

十、进行需求评审和总结

需求评审和总结是需求信息管理系统实施后的重要环节。需求评审是对需求实现情况进行评估,检查需求是否得到满足,系统是否符合预期目标。需求总结是对需求管理过程进行总结,分析需求管理的成功和不足之处,为以后的项目提供经验和教训。

需求评审和总结可以通过需求评审会议、用户反馈、项目总结报告等方式进行。通过需求评审和总结,您可以不断改进需求信息管理系统,提高项目的成功率。

通过上述步骤,您可以明确需求信息管理系统,确保需求管理过程有序进行,提高项目的成功率。选择合适的需求管理工具,如PingCode或Worktile,可以帮助您更好地实现需求信息管理系统的目标。【PingCode官网】【Worktile官网】

相关问答FAQs:

1. 什么是需求信息管理系统? 需求信息管理系统是一种用于组织、存储和跟踪项目需求的工具。它可以帮助团队明确项目需求,并确保所有相关人员都能够获得和理解这些需求。

2. 需求信息管理系统有哪些功能? 需求信息管理系统通常具有以下功能:需求收集和整理、需求分析和评估、需求跟踪和追踪、需求变更管理和版本控制等。这些功能可以帮助团队更好地管理项目需求,确保项目顺利进行。

3. 如何选择适合的需求信息管理系统? 选择适合的需求信息管理系统时,可以考虑以下几个因素:团队规模、项目复杂度、预算限制和团队成员的技术能力。另外,还可以参考用户评价和市场口碑,选择一款功能齐全、易于使用且适合团队需求的系统。

4. 需求信息管理系统如何帮助团队明确需求? 需求信息管理系统可以通过提供需求收集和整理的功能,帮助团队明确项目需求。团队成员可以在系统中记录和整理需求,并进行分类和优先级排序。这样可以确保所有的需求都被收集到,并且团队成员可以更好地理解和共享这些需求。

5. 需求信息管理系统是否适用于所有类型的项目? 需求信息管理系统可以适用于各种类型的项目,包括软件开发、产品设计、市场营销等。无论是小型项目还是大型项目,都可以使用需求信息管理系统来帮助团队明确需求,并提高项目的成功率。

声明:本文来自用户分享和网络收集,仅供学习与参考,测试请备份。